2004 Pontiac GTO Car Stereo Wiring Diagram
This 2004 Pontiac GTO radio wiring chart shows you all the 2004 Pontiac GTO stereo wire color codes and their radio wire functions. This easy-to-follow guide can help you install a new car stereo or figure out problems with your stereo wiring harness and radio setup. If you don’t see the car radio wiring information you’re looking for, please feel free to ask your question at the bottom of this page.
| Car Stereo Wire Function | Wire Color Code |
|---|---|
| Car Radio Battery Wire (Constant 12v+) | Orange/Black |
| Car Radio Accessory Wire (Switched 12v+) | Yellow |
| Ground Wire | Black/White |

| Illumination Wire | Brown/White |
| Dimmer Wire | Brown |
| Antenna Trigger Wire | N/A |
| Car Radio Amp Trigger Wire | N/A |
| Amplifier Location | N/A |
2004 Pontiac GTO Speaker Wiring Guide
This 2004 Pontiac GTO speaker wiring chart shows you every speaker wire color and the speaker wire polarity. Use this 2004 Pontiac GTO chart makes it easy to identify each wire and where it connects. | Car Stereo Wire Function | Wire Color Code |
|---|---|
| Front Left Speaker Positive Wire (+) | Tan |
| Front Left Speaker Negative Wire (-) | Gray |
| Front Right Speaker Positive Wire (+) | Light Green |
| Front Right Speaker Negative Wire (-) | Dark Green |
| Rear Left Speaker Positive Wire (+) | Brown/Black |
| Rear Left Speaker Negative Wire (-) | Yellow/Blue |
| Rear Right Speaker Positive Wire (+) | Blue/Orange |
| Rear Right Speaker Negative Wire (-) | Blue/Black |
| Subwoofer Left Positive Wire (+) | Brown/Black (Same Wire as Rear Left Speaker) |
| Subwoofer Left Negative Wire (-) | Yellow/Blue (Same Wire as Rear Left Speaker) |
| Subwoofer Right Positive Wire (+) | Blue/Orange (Same Wire as Rear Right Speaker) |
| Subwoofer Right Negative Wire (-) | Blue/Black (Same Wire as Rear Right Speaker) |

2004 Pontiac GTO Speaker Sizes and Locations
This 2004 Pontiac GTO speaker guide includes speaker sizes, speaker locations, and helpful info on speaker upgrades. Use this chart to find out what size speakers fit your 2004 Pontiac GTO.
| Application | Speaker Size/Location |
|---|---|
| Dash Center Speaker Size | N/A |
| Dash Center Speaker Depth | N/A |
| Dash Center Speaker Location | N/A |
| Front Tweeter Size | N/A |
| Front Tweeter Depth | N/A |
| Front Tweeter Location | N/A |
| Front Speaker Size | 3 1/2″ Speakers |
| Front Speaker Depth | N/A |
| Front Speaker Location | Dash |
| Rear Tweeter Size | N/A |
| Rear Tweeter Depth | N/A |
| Rear Tweeter Location | N/A |
| Rear Speaker Size | 6 1/2″ Speakers |
| Rear Speaker Depth | N/A |
| Rear Speaker Location | Rear Deck |
| Subwoofer Size | N/A |
| Subwoofer Depth | N/A |
| Subwoofer Location | N/A |

I have a quick question. i just installed a brand new head unit stereo (sony xplod) for my 2004 pontiac gto. nothing too big or fancy, just a regular stereo. for some reason, every time i try to store my radio stations it doesn’t save. that’s every time i take the key out of the ignition its like i never stored my stations at all. so i have to store them every time i turn on the car and when i take the key out its all lost. any ideas? i took it to the place where they installed it and they said my car is basically like a Cadillac that it doesn’t have a memory? any ideas if maybe the wires are cross wrong or something?
John, you may have mixed up the battery constant and accessory switched wires. The battery constant always sends power to the radio to save your radio stations and other audio settings. The accessory switched wire sends power to your radio only when the key is in the ignition and your 2004 Pontiac GTO is on. Check your wiring and make sure the correct radio wires are hooked up to the correct wires on your factory harness. Hope this helps. Good luck with your 2004 Pontiac GTO radio installation.
